From 1912 to 1944, Sinai Temple dominated the southwest corner of 46th and Grand Boulevard (King Drive). Alfred Alschuler designed this Italian Renaissance style temple for Chicago's first Reform synagogue, founded in 1861. The building now houses Mt. Pisgah Missionary Baptist Church, one of the largest black congregations in Grand Boulevard. [G. Lane]
